“Quite simply incredible” was the way Mayor Ed Lee described Apple’s plans for a store at Post and Stockton streets. That was a couple of weeks ago. Now that a furor has erupted over the removal of artist Ruth Asawa’s public fountain along Stockton Street to accommodate the store, the mayor is having second thoughts. “We weren’t necessarily focused on that side. It wasn’t part of our discussion,” he tells the Chronicle.
